1995 Rover - Austin 200 214 SLi review from UK and Ireland
"An underrated bargain - economical and not slow!"
What things have gone wrong with the car?
Head gasket recently went, bit of a bummer as I had only just bought the car - an independant garage fixed it but didn't tighten up the radiator hoses very well so had some coolant leaks - as a result check the levels very frequently because I don't trust it. When it comes down to it, just the head gasket.
General comments?
Great little car - where else can you get a nippy, economical, not bad looking, practical, and also quite fun car for 3 grand??
Okay, not the last word in comfort or looks, but I get about 38-40mpg when driving in town, and it has a 0-60 that will put some much bigger cars to shame (BMW 318, Cavalier 1.8) at just over 10 secs.
Loaded down with kit too - pick of the range would be the SEi with alloys and leather seats!
